Pekingese Pup Chow: Your Guide to the Best Bites

Finding the right dog food for your Pekingese is important. These little dogs have unique needs. This guide will help you choose the perfect food for your furry friend.

Key Features to Look For

You need to find food that is made for small breeds. Pekingese dogs have small mouths and bodies. Here are some key things to look for:

  • Small Kibble Size: The pieces of food should be small. This makes it easy for your Pekingese to eat and digest.
  • High-Quality Protein: Look for real meat like chicken, lamb, or fish listed as the first ingredient. Protein helps build strong muscles.
  • Moderate Fat Levels: Pekingese dogs can gain weight easily. The food should have a healthy amount of fat for energy.
  • Added Fiber: Fiber helps with digestion. Look for ingredients like sweet potatoes or peas.
  • Joint Support: Pekingese dogs can have joint problems. Look for food with glucosamine and chondroitin. These can help keep their joints healthy.

Important Materials in Dog Food

The ingredients in dog food matter. Here’s what to look for:

  • Real Meat: Chicken, lamb, or fish should be the primary ingredient.
  • Healthy Grains or Vegetables: Things like brown rice, oats, sweet potatoes, and peas are good. They provide energy and fiber.
  • Vitamins and Minerals: The food should be fortified with essential vitamins and minerals.
  • Avoid Fillers: Stay away from foods with a lot of corn, wheat, or soy. These can be hard to digest and don’t offer much nutrition.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What is the best type of food for a Pekingese?

A: High-quality dry food made for small breeds is usually a good choice. You can also offer wet food or a mix of both.

Q: How much should I feed my Pekingese?

A: Follow the feeding guidelines on the food package. Also, consider your dog’s age, weight, and activity level. Your vet can help you determine the right amount.

Q: What ingredients should I avoid?

A: Avoid foods with a lot of corn, wheat, soy, and artificial ingredients.

Q: Can I give my Pekingese human food?

A: Some human foods are okay in small amounts. Avoid chocolate, grapes, onions, and other foods that are toxic to dogs.

Q: What if my Pekingese has allergies?

A: Talk to your vet. They can help you find a food that is free of the ingredients that cause allergies.

Q: Should I feed my Pekingese puppy food?

A: Yes, puppy food is made for their special nutritional needs. It helps them grow properly.

Q: When should I switch to adult food?

A: Usually, you can switch when your Pekingese is about a year old. However, some dogs may need a different timeline. Consult your vet.

Q: What if my Pekingese is a picky eater?

A: Try different flavors or textures. You could add a little wet food to the dry food. Make sure to consult your vet.

Q: How can I tell if the food is good quality?

A: Look at the ingredient list. The first few ingredients should be high-quality protein sources. Also, check for any added vitamins, minerals, and avoid any artificial ingredients.
